Title

Design and Performance of a Vehicle Radiator Using GD Doped CeO2 and ZnO Nanofluids by CFD Analysis

Abstract

In the development of the many modern technology, the main challenge is thermal management. If we look towards automobile sector, the thermal management is the most difficult challenge. Nanofluids are suspension of Nano particles into the base fluid in different compositions. It helps to increase the heat transfer rate of various applications. The objective of this experimental study is to discuss the thermal performance of car radiator using Zinc Oxide (ZnO) and Gadnolinium doped ceria (Gd CeO2) nano fluid in temperature ranges from (40-80°C) in three different values and different fractions of nano particles from 0.5 and 1.0% (by volume). The heat transfer with water and ethylene glycol based nano fluids are experimentally compare to that of mixture of water and ethylene glycol as coolant in an automobile radiator. By varying the amount of ZnO and Gd CeO2 nano particles blended with base fluid, there different concentrations of nano fluid 0.5 and 1.0% obtain. The size of nano particle used is 30 nm (Nano meter). Liquid flow rate has been taken as 2 lpm (Liter per minute) and air velocity in the range of 3.5 m/s and 6.5 m/s. The design and simulation are done in SOLID WORKS, ANSYS R15.0. Finally compare with the base fluid results.
